We will be boarding the Viking Star in Venice for a cruise to Athens, Greece in May 2018. The pre-cruise package is quite pricey so we are looking for a recommendation for a nice hotel in the area close to sight seeing destinations. Thank you.

Recommend: Al Ponte Mocenigo.

 

Very reasonable and rated high on Trip Advisor.

 

No bridges to cross with your luggage.

 

There is a Vaporetto stop close to the rear entrance.

I stayed pre-cruise at the Hotel Olimpia, a Best Western property, which is close to the Piazzale Roma, transportation hub for Venice. The People Mover to the cruise port is accessed from the Piazzale, and it is also where the buses from the airport drop passengers off in the city. It's obviously an old residence that was converted into a hotel, and is located on one of the smaller canals. My room was charmingly decorated, the bathroom was very modern, the staff was pleasant and helpful, there is an elevator in the hotel, and they offer a very nice breakfast buffet. Considering how expensive hotels seem to be in Venice, I felt it was a decent value.

I see that one poster told you about the Best Western Hotel Olimpia. We stayed there in 2013 and it was delightful. Close to everything and the hotel had a lovely back yard for relaxing. Address is 395 Fondamenta Delle Burchiel, Santa Croce, Venice. You won't be disappointed!
